The stars watch as De La Soul and Afrika Bambaataa show why the label is so revered...
The show is part of an anniversary tour that will see the Tommy Boy collective perform in Ireland, Scotland, and mainland Europe.
Joining Bambaataa and De La Soul's Maceo on the decks were Dan The Automator - Albarn's partner in the Gorillaz project - and legendary producer Arthur Baker.
Speaking to NMEHIPHOP.COM just after the show, Maceo explained what could be expected from the tour.
"Everybody's pretty much playing what they feel for the most part," he said. "I play mostly late 80s early 90s, also some old breaks from the mid-70s and early 80s. With 'Bam and Dan The Automator and Arthur - it's interesting to hear them play some new stuff from today in their set, letting me know that they was feeling some stuff that's out there today. So, there's a pretty good balance with what is going on and it was just a good party, everybody had a great time."
As reported on NME.COM earlier today, Wyclef also appeared at the Usher gig last night, joining him on stage at Hammersmith Apollo for some impromptu freestyling before heading off to the Tommy Boy party.
The Tommy Boy tour continues with a show in Dublin tonight (July 6).
